I am a FA06 user for the last 5 years. Never had issues with MIDI and FA06 but I ran into this issue:

I am trying to control the FA from an external Keyboard (and daw). I am using 3 external synths and they are connected with MIDI and not USB.
My problem is -
My Korg synth (used as keyboard controller) is set to receive in Ch 1 - When played with my controller Keyboard - I only hear it.
My MODX7 is set to receive in Ch2 - When played with my controller Keyboard - I only hear it.
I tried setting the FA to Ch3 but it recieves in all channels which make it unusable for me.
- When played with my controller Keyboard - I hear it and the controller ...

Where can I set it to only one RX channel.
I am not trying to use it as a multi sound setup.

I think what you need to do is just make sure no FA sound is assigned to channels 1 or 2. Either by muting Parts 1 and 2 of a Studio Set, or by changing Parts 1 and 2 to some channels other than their default 1 and 2. Then you should not hear the FA when you are sending MIDI on channels 1 or 2.

I got a similar problem:
I use a Keystep Pro with 4-sequencer tracks as my master.
I hooked up a drum machine and two synths as slaves on tracks 1, 2 and 4 via the respective midi-out channel (1, 2, 4) and everything works fine.
Now I tried to hook up my FA-06 as a slave to track / channel 3 and it does not work as I want it to.
Obviously there is no global midi receive channel available on the FA-06 - when toggle "remote keyboard" is on the FA receives from all (16) incoming midi-channels.
Unfortunately muting parts etc. in PARTS VIEW does not help at all...

Go to Part View/ Midi RX Filter page. RX stands for receive midi. Turn off all the channels that you don't want to sound when midi is input on it. So just leave channel 3 on and it will ignore midi received on other channels.Lea ve remote keyboard alone/off.

OK ! I found : first panel of Part View/Level Pan, last parameter on the right, you can choose the RX channel for each voice.
It brings me to another question : what is the global midi channel and where to parameter it ?

In order to control the global volume of the synth, you should send a CC7 midi parameter. If I choose the channel where my parts/sounds are, it works, but it put each part assigned to that channel are putted to the same volume level when controlled by an outside keyboard.
I need to keep the difference level of each part.
Thats why, for example on Nord Stage 2 we ve got a midi global channel where we control the CC7 volume midi message for the whole synth.

It's surely possible on the FA06 ... but where ?

OK found it again for thoses who would have the same problem/question : send CC11 (expression) and note CC7 (volume) on the channel where the parts are. It will change the volume proportionaly of their initial volume and so, keep the difference between each one.
